You already have your own domain with the dot com so let’s just use that domain for everything. First step is to open your own store. Use Wordpress for this. Install the Wordpress in the dot com /shop domain. It’s just installing it in your domain under the shop subdomain. This will allow you to have a second website under the same domain with independent themes, posts, pages, plugins, users and much more.
Second thing to do is to find a way to sell with that website. You need to make a products description plus you need some software or tools to sell. You can buy shopping cart software, you can use Paypal, you can use Clickbank, you can do almost anything here, you can even use some Wordpress extensions to make this sale. I leave this up to you, however I would give Click2sell a try.
Once you add your products to sell under the shop subdomain it’s time to make some ads to add to your main blog to the traffic can come to your shop. Remove your Adsense/Adbrite/Clickbank ads and make your own ads. Your Click2Sell products have a special link pointing to the checkout page. You need to pick that link and make a HTML link with your own sentences. Make a small tittle in blue and then a description in black, just like you would do with Adwords. Now with the BR HTML tag add another add to another product below and so on until you have the amount of products you would like to have.
Now just place this on your website and enjoy the traffic coming.
If you do not want to display the same ads over and other again you can use some Javascript to randomize the ads served. You will randomize the HTML links. Find something on Google that fits your needs. It does exist and I use it frequently so search for it.
